Sinbad: A Musical Journey
In the Western world, the story of Sinbad and his travels is known primarily as a romanticized fairy tale that has little to do with the origins of the mythical figure in the Arabic collection *One Thousand and One Nights*.
Syrian ney virtuoso Moslem Rahal and the instrumentalists and singers of his ensemble, who hail from various countries and regions of the Middle East, portray the sailor as a wanderer between worlds: an emigrant who, in search of a better life, seeks exchange with other civilizations and—like the musicians themselves—unites the most diverse cultural influences within himself.
With their program, they follow in Sinbad’s footsteps on a musical journey through space and time that confronts the audience with universal and deeply human truths.
